我有一个带有下拉列表的屏幕,它是从数据库动态填充的。我使用phonegap和jquery Mobile。这些值可以完美地添加到下拉列表中,但其中一个值应该是预先选定的。问题是,当屏幕显示时,字段中没有选定的值(图1)。但当我打开下拉菜单时,预先选择的值会突出显示(图2)。我使用jquery 1.8.3和jquery mobile 1.2.0。
图1:
图2:
下面是我的代码:
selectSubjectsSuccess: function(tx, results){
var len = results.rows.length;
var selVa
我在试着切换菜单上的项目。现在,我有3个图标,当他们被点击,UL下拉-移动在点击图标下打开。单击“主菜单项”时,“子菜单项”应滑动打开,单击“子菜单项”,“子菜单项”应滑动打开。现在,我似乎只能滑动打开UL下拉移动,但我不知道如何使它,以便我可以切换子菜单在里面。
因此,我有以下布局作为菜单:
// slideToggle for mobile mainmenu
$('li.icons-list').click(function(e) {
if ($(this).siblings('li.hovertest').find('ul.dropdown
在由Rails 6.1控制的网站表单上,我希望实现一个“动态”或级联下拉菜单,以便第二个下拉菜单中的选项根据第一个下拉菜单中选定的项而变化。
具体来说,我有一个与Country和Town模型相关联的Town模型。关系是Person belongs_to a Town,belongs_to a Country in has_many.方法定义Country#name和Town#name。在网站create a Person的新表单中,用户首先从下拉菜单(选择框)中选择一个国家,然后在第二个下拉菜单中选择一个城镇。
我基本上遵循了过程,但在标准jQuery中重写了它,而不是Railcast中的Co
我正在尝试添加下拉菜单按钮到一个网站的响应顶部导航,我正在从这个colorlib模板制作。
function adventures() {
$("#adventures").toggleClass("show");
}
下面的.appendTo()方法破坏了桌面视图中的下拉按钮,但它们在非画布菜单中的移动屏幕大小上有效。
$('.js-clone-nav').each(function() {
var $this = $(this);
// suppsoed to copy everything under js-clone-nav int
我有一个函数,它将一个类应用于html元素,并检测下拉菜单是否在900px的宽度下被单击。
当我将浏览器的大小从桌面视图调整到900px以下时,我偶尔会发现下拉类"active-hit“无法应用--这意味着菜单不会打开。你知道为什么会这样吗?我必须重新加载页面才能使其在移动视图中工作。
// Add Mobile View Class to HTML ELEMENT below 900px
(function($) {
var $window = $(window),
$html = $('html');
$dropdown = $('.drop
我在一个遗留网站上工作,这个网站有很多问题,但其中一个问题真的很令人恼火和困惑。它有一个下拉菜单,只需使用jquery条件切换即可。
问题是-当我在iPhone/Android上打开它并试图向下滚动查看其余菜单项时,菜单消失了。
下面是加载它的脚本:
/* MOBILE COLLAPSE MENU */
;(function ($) {
$.fn.collapsable = function (options) {
// iterate and reformat each matched element
return this.each(function () {
// cac